25PX47MEFC5X11 - Rubycon - Aluminum Electrolytic Capacitors

25PX47MEFC5X11

Rubycon

CAP ALUM 47UF 20% 25V RADIAL

25PX47MEFC5X11 is a Aluminum Electrolytic Capacitors manufactured by Rubycon. CAP ALUM 47UF 20% 25V RADIAL. Key specifications: mounting type Through Hole, operating temperature -55°C ~ 105°C, voltage - rated 25 V, package / case Radial, Can.
